What is a Rent To Own Car Contract?
The Rent To Own Car Contract serves as an alternative financing solution for vehicle acquisition in England and Wales, particularly suitable for individuals who prefer a gradual path to ownership or may not qualify for traditional auto loans. This contract type combines the immediate accessibility of a rental agreement with the long-term benefit of ownership, typically including detailed terms about payment schedules, maintenance responsibilities, and ownership transfer conditions. When implementing a Rent To Own Car Contract, parties must comply with stringent consumer protection regulations, including the Consumer Credit Act 1974 and FCA guidelines, ensuring fair treatment and transparent terms for all parties involved.

Key legal considerations
Several critical legal elements must be carefully addressed in your Rent To Own Car Contract. Payment terms require precise specification, including total purchase price, deposit amounts, monthly payment schedules, and any applicable interest rates or fees. Vehicle condition and maintenance responsibilities need clear delineation between parties, particularly regarding insurance requirements, repairs, and upkeep during the rental period. Ownership transfer conditions must be explicitly defined, including when title passes to the renter and what happens in case of default or early termination. Consumer protection clauses should address your rights regarding vehicle quality, fitness for purpose, and remedies for contract breaches. Default provisions must specify consequences for missed payments, repossession procedures, and any remaining financial obligations.
Legal requirements in England and Wales
Under England and Wales law, your Rent To Own Car Contract must comply with comprehensive consumer credit regulations. The Consumer Credit Act 1974 governs credit agreements and hire purchase contracts, requiring specific information disclosure, consumer rights protection, and proper credit licensing for providers. FCA authorization may be required for entities offering regulated credit activities, and all financial promotions must comply with Financial Services and Markets Act 2000 requirements. The Consumer Rights Act 2015 defines your rights regarding vehicle quality, fitness for purpose, and protection against unfair contract terms. Vehicle-specific obligations under the Road Traffic Act 1988 must be addressed, including roadworthiness requirements and continuous insurance coverage. The contract must include mandatory cooling-off periods, clear total cost calculations, and proper dispute resolution procedures as required by consumer credit regulations.
